Description
PCGS 1864 PR 64. A low-mintage Civil War era proof (mintage 470 pcs.), toned in violet and steely-gray shades.
Coin Index Numbers: (NGC ID# 27CA, PCGS# 3714, Greysheet# 3679)
Weight: 0.75 grams
Metal: 90% Silver, 10% Copper
